Output e179b200b6a227072e85bfc537f68aa01223b91d940e484e35b99033c54d18c4:0

value
18595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45cb38f19eb2a617327835a3715f2e2e9953449e OP_EQUAL
address
3843zvTZhPDfPfxCdZKwJZsvP7ocSSyWZ4
transaction
e179b200b6a227072e85bfc537f68aa01223b91d940e484e35b99033c54d18c4
spent
true